Out-of-Bounds Planets in Astrology: Meaning and Calculation

A planet is out of bounds when its geocentric declination lies north or south beyond the Sun's maximum declination, using a stated threshold for the date.

In astrology, an out-of-bounds planet has a declination farther north or south of the celestial equator than the Sun can reach. Declination is an equatorial coordinate measured in degrees north or south. A common fixed rule marks a body out of bounds beyond about 23 degrees 26 minutes, but Earth's obliquity changes slowly, so precise work should use the date-specific value or disclose the fixed threshold used.

Out of bounds is not a zodiac sign, house, aspect in longitude, retrograde condition, or speed category. It answers one coordinate question: does the body's absolute geocentric declination exceed the selected solar limit? Record the timestamp, viewpoint, declination source, direction, and threshold before adding any interpretation.

What does out of bounds mean in astrology?

The celestial equator projects Earth's equator into the sky. Declination measures angular distance from it: north is positive and south is negative in many ephemerides. Because the Sun follows the ecliptic, its declination stays between limits set by Earth's axial tilt. The Moon and planets can have ecliptic latitude as well as longitude, allowing their declination to cross beyond that solar range. Astrologers call that condition out of bounds, often abbreviated OOB.

Declination is not zodiac longitude

Longitude places a body around the ecliptic in signs and degrees. Declination measures distance north or south of the celestial equator. Two planets can share a zodiac degree while having different declinations, or share a declination while occupying different signs. Changing from tropical to sidereal longitude does not by itself decide OOB status because the test uses an equatorial coordinate. Software settings still matter, so confirm that you are reading declination rather than celestial latitude.

What threshold should you use?

The often quoted boundary of 23 degrees 26 minutes approximates Earth's obliquity for modern dates. The true mean or apparent obliquity varies with date and definition. A body near the boundary can therefore be classified differently by a fixed conventional rule and a date-specific astronomical rule. Either approach can be documented, but do not claim minute-level precision while leaving the boundary unstated. The Sun itself reaches the boundary seasonally and does not exceed its own date-specific limit.

How to calculate an out-of-bounds planet

  1. Fix the moment

    Use the exact date, time, and time zone for the natal event or transit being studied.

  2. Choose the viewpoint

    Use geocentric declination unless a different method is explicitly intended and documented.

  3. Read the declination

    Record the body's degrees and minutes plus N or S, or preserve the sign of a decimal value.

  4. Set the solar boundary

    Use a named fixed limit or calculate the selected date-specific obliquity from the same astronomical source.

  5. Compare absolute values

    The body is OOB only when the magnitude of its declination exceeds the boundary; retain north or south for interpretation and verification.

A worked declination example

Suppose an ephemeris gives Mars a geocentric declination of 24 degrees 08 minutes north and the declared boundary is 23 degrees 26 minutes. The absolute declination exceeds the limit by 42 minutes, so Mars is out of bounds north under that rule. If Venus is 23 degrees 20 minutes south, its magnitude remains inside the same boundary. The signs containing Mars and Venus do not change this comparison.

Which planets can go out of bounds?

The Moon can exceed the solar limit, and Mercury, Venus, Mars, Jupiter, Uranus, Pluto, and some minor bodies can do so at certain times. Occurrence and duration vary because each orbit has a different inclination and geometry. Saturn and Neptune remain within or very close to the solar declination range in ordinary modern geocentric tables, so do not assume every planet has frequent OOB periods. Check the actual ephemeris rather than a memorized list.

North and south out of bounds

Both directions meet the same magnitude test. A declination of +24 degrees is north OOB and -24 degrees is south OOB under a 23-degree-26-minute threshold. North is not automatically constructive and south is not automatically difficult. Direction is astronomical information, not a moral ranking. Preserve it because two bodies on the same side can form a parallel and bodies at equal opposite declinations can form a contraparallel.

Out-of-bounds planets in a natal chart

Modern astrologers often interpret an OOB planet as operating beyond familiar solar limits, using themes such as independence, exception, excess, unusual expression, or difficulty with convention. Those are symbolic hypotheses, not traits proved by the coordinate. Read the planet's sign, house, rulership, aspects, condition, and lived context. An OOB Mercury cannot diagnose neurodivergence, and an OOB Mars cannot establish aggression, criminality, courage, or exceptional talent.

The Moon out of bounds

Because lunar declination changes quickly, the Moon may cross the boundary and return within a relatively short interval. In natal work, some astrologers emphasize emotional autonomy, strong responses, or unconventional habits. In transit work, the condition is brief and common enough to require restraint. It cannot predict an emotional crisis, accident, market move, public disturbance, or personal breakthrough. Track the precise ingress and egress before attaching a story.

Out-of-bounds transits and return dates

For a transit, find when the body first crosses the selected boundary, reaches maximum declination, and returns inside. If the body later repeats the condition after a retrograde loop, record each interval separately. The OOB window describes declination, while exact aspects in longitude have their own dates. A long interval creates a study period, not a guarantee that the symbolism will dominate every event.

Parallels, contraparallels, and OOB are different tests

A parallel occurs when two bodies have similar declinations on the same side of the equator; a contraparallel uses similar magnitudes on opposite sides. Either aspect can occur inside or outside the solar boundary. OOB describes one body relative to the solar limit. A declination aspect compares two bodies with a stated orb. Keep those calculations separate even when they appear together.

Why astrology programs disagree

Differences can come from geocentric versus topocentric coordinates, true versus mean positions, ephemeris version, timestamp conversion, rounding, or use of a fixed rather than date-specific boundary. Compare the raw declination and threshold before comparing labels. A one-minute rounding difference matters only for a body almost exactly on the line. If the raw coordinates match, the disagreement is probably definitional rather than astronomical.

OOB is not retrograde, stationary, or peregrine

Retrograde and stationary describe apparent longitudinal motion and its reversal. Planetary speed compares motion over time. Peregrine is a traditional essential-dignity test by sign and degree. Out of bounds uses declination relative to a solar boundary. A planet may hold several conditions at once, but one does not imply another. Name each calculation instead of compressing them into a general label of “unusual.”

Limits of out-of-bounds interpretation

Out-of-bounds declination is a real astronomical coordinate condition, while its astrological meaning is interpretive. It cannot establish diagnosis, identity, genius, danger, relationship fate, career success, legal outcome, disaster, or financial movement. Use it as one documented chart factor and do not replace medical, legal, financial, or mental health guidance with a declination label.
